What Is A 4Runner Catalytic Converter Shield?
A 4Runner catalytic converter shield is a protective accessory designed specifically for Toyota 4Runner vehicles. Its primary function is to shield the catalytic converter from physical damage and theft. The catalytic converter is a crucial component of a vehicle's exhaust system, responsible for reducing harmful emissions. Because of its value, it is often targeted by thieves who want to sell it for its precious metals.
These shields are typically made from durable materials like steel or aluminum and are designed to fit securely around the catalytic converter. Apart from theft protection, the shield also provides additional insulation, which can help in maintaining optimal operating temperatures for the catalytic converter. This not only enhances its efficiency but also prolongs its lifespan. Overall, a 4Runner catalytic converter shield proves to be a practical investment for 4Runner owners looking to safeguard one of their vehicle's most important components.
Benefits Of Installing A 4Runner Catalytic Converter Shield
Installing a 4runner catalytic converter shield offers several advantages that enhance vehicle performance, longevity, and security. Here are some of the key benefits:
- Protection Against Theft: One of the primary benefits of a catalytic converter shield is its ability to deter thieves. Catalytic converters contain precious metals such as platinum, palladium, and rhodium, making them prime targets for theft. A robust shield acts as a physical barrier, making it more difficult for thieves to access and remove the converter.
- Heat Management: A 4runner catalytic converter shield can help in managing the heat produced by the exhaust system. By containing and directing heat, the shield can help prevent damage to surrounding components and decrease the risk of fires caused by excessive heat buildup.
- Improved Durability: The shield adds an extra layer of protection to the catalytic converter, safeguarding it from road debris, impacts, and corrosion. This can result in a longer lifespan for the catalytic converter, ultimately saving you money on repairs and replacements.
- Enhanced Performance: When installed correctly, a shield can maintain optimal operating temperatures for the catalytic converter, allowing it to function more efficiently. This can lead to improved vehicle performance and fuel efficiency.
- Custom Fit and Easy Installation: Many 4runner catalytic converter shields are designed specifically for various 4Runner models, ensuring a perfect fit. Most guards come with easy-to-follow installation instructions, making the process straightforward for vehicle owners.
Incorporating a 4runner catalytic converter shield not only addresses security concerns but also contributes to the overall efficiency and longevity of your vehicle's exhaust system. Investing in this protective accessory can prove beneficial for both your vehicle and peace of mind.

Installation Process For A 4Runner Catalytic Converter Shield
Installing a 4runner catalytic converter shield is a crucial step in protecting your vehicle's catalytic converter from theft and damage. Here’s a step-by-step guide to ensure a successful installation:
- Gather Necessary Tools: Before you start, make sure you have all the required tools. You'll typically need:
Tool Purpose Socket wrench To remove and secure bolts Ratchet For tightening connections Jack and jack stands To lift the vehicle safely Torque wrench To ensure bolts are tightened to the proper specifications - Lift the Vehicle: Use a jack to lift your 4Runner and secure it on jack stands. Make sure it's stable before crawling underneath.
- Locate the Catalytic Converter: Identify the position of the catalytic converter, usually located in the exhaust system.
- Remove Existing Bolts: Using a socket wrench, carefully unscrew any bolts or brackets currently securing the catalytic converter.
- Position the Shield: Once the catalytic converter is accessible, place the 4runner catalytic converter shield over it, ensuring that it aligns with the mounting holes.
- Secure the Shield: Insert the provided bolts through the shield holes and into the mounting points. Use your socket wrench to fasten them but do not overtighten yet.
- Tighten the Bolts: Utilizing a torque wrench, tighten the bolts to the manufacturer's specifications to ensure the shield is firmly attached.
- Inspect Your Work: Before lowering the vehicle, double-check that the shield is secure and that all tools have been removed from underneath the vehicle.
- Lower the Vehicle: Carefully remove the jack stands and lower your 4Runner back to the ground.
Following these steps will help you successfully install a 4runner catalytic converter shield, enhancing your vehicle's protection against potential threats. Regular checks after the installation are also advisable to ensure everything remains secured.
Common Issues With 4Runner Catalytic Converter Shields And Solutions
While a 4runner catalytic converter shield can provide essential protection for your vehicle's catalytic converter, it may encounter some common issues. Here are a few typical problems that might arise, along with their solutions:
- Rust and Corrosion: Over time, exposure to elements can lead to rust on the shield, compromising its effectiveness. To combat this, regularly inspect the shield and apply high-temperature paint or rust-resistant coating to protect it.
- Improper Fit: In some cases, a shield might not fit correctly, leading to vibrations or rattling noises. Ensure that the shield is compatible with your specific model and consult the installation instructions for proper fitment.
- Loose Bolts or Fasteners: Vibration can cause bolts or fasteners holding the shield to loosen. Periodically check all fastenings and tighten them if needed. Using Loctite or similar thread-locking adhesives can help keep them secure.
- Heat Damage: Excessive heat can warp or damage the shield over time. Make sure the shield is made from materials that withstand high temperatures and consider additional heat shields if necessary.
- Obstacle Damage: Off-roading or driving over obstacles may lead to physical damage of the shield. Inspect the shield frequently for dents or cracks and replace if structural integrity is compromised.
By keeping an eye on these common issues and implementing the suggested solutions, you can ensure that your 4runner catalytic converter shield remains effective in protecting your vehicle's catalytic converter for years to come.

How much does a catalytic converter shield for a 4runner cost?
The cost of a catalytic converter shield for a 4runner can vary widely depending on the brand and quality, typically ranging from $100 to $300, not including installation costs.
